67 Cohasset is located in Boston, near the intersection of Harvard Street and Beacon Street. This low-rise building stands at 2 stories and was built in 1900. It features a total of 7 condominium units, ranging from 1,366 to 1,391 square feet. The property is close to the Charles River, adding to the neighborhood’s charm. The available units include 2 and 3 bedrooms, appealing to different household sizes. Prices for these condos range from $555,000 to $630,000. Roslindale is a Boston neighborhood with a lively village center. The area mixes small shops, cafes, and varied restaurants along walkable streets. It has parks, playgrounds, green space for outdoor time, and a weekly farmers market with regular local events. You can find a public library and basic services like banks, grocery stores, and schools. Local shops host art shows and small festivals on weekends. Transit options include bus routes and commuter rail links into downtown Boston. The area sits near major roads for convenient car access.
